A pox on all bike thieves.

Both Adrian's bikes have been stolen.
Fugi sportif 1.1 2014
Cube acid 27.5 2016

Stolen from a back garden shed on Wednesday 27th at approx 2AM in Draycott, Derbyshire. Thieves removed 18 screws from the door hinges, and passed bikes over the fence and went through neighbouring garden, may be able to get hold of some cctv footage but will know for sure tonight.
Cube has red bar ends and charge spoon saddle and Garmin mount, other than that, standard. Was only bought in march this year and has done about 500 miles.
The fugi, has a charge spoon saddle as well, wear on rear seat post from saddle bag, has transparent frame protectors fitted near all cables and grey light reflective tape, left STI leaver is slightly faulty to operate, red hope bar ends also has white elite Canada flag bottlecages fitted.
